> > This works as follows:
> > - buildonly: produces a patched version of LTP, builds it and
> > generates a tar.gz file that you have to install in your target rootfs.
> > - runonly: skips build and deploy, and runs the LTP binaries that you
> > installed on the target rootfs.
> >
> > Non-patched versions of LTP are not supported by the parser.
